‘Everyone I Know Is Playing It’: New Canaan Caught Up in ‘Pokemon Go’ Craze

For Anna Krolikowski, a New Canaan High School class of 1987 graduate, it seemed for a moment as though the town had been cast back to a simpler, less technological era. Driving to Bankwell on Elm Street on Monday, Krolikowski (née Valente) spotted four kids lying belly-down, on the grass outside. “I thought, ‘Oh look, how nice, they’re just chilling out. Kids being normal kids again,’ ” said Krolikowski, owner of Baskin Robbins on Main Street. “But they’re all on their phones.
